Financial Divisions is seeking a Technical Paraplanner to join their team in the City of London. This role offers a hybrid working model with 3 days in the office and 2 days from home, providing exposure to high-net-worth clients. The successful candidate will work closely with Financial Advisers and will have clear pathways to progress into an Adviser role.
Responsibilities include:
- Preparing cashflow modelling
- Supporting advisers
- Conducting product research
Candidates should possess a Level 4 Diploma in Regulated Financial Planning and have at least 3 years of paraplanning experience.
